Question Need some help with some Avidlite products - 'Zero net carbs'?

Hi,

I have been browsing the products on Avidlite website.

I am now a little confused, in the titles of some products it says 'Zero net carbs' then when I look at the nutritional info it says something different.

Here is an example of some sweets:
Quote:
Zero net carbs. Great for diabetics and low carb dieters (Atkins).

Nutritional information per 100g (tin is 175g): 240 kCal, Protein nil, Carbohydrates 97g of which sugars zero, Polyols 97g, giving "net carbs" of zero, Starch zero, Fat zero, Fibre zero, Sodium zero.


Ok so could someone help me out? it says zero net carbs but then says 97g carbs!? I'm a little confused, which is probably stupid, sorry. It's obvioulsy something to do with Polyols... and I know nothing about that.

When low carbing I simply eat meats, cheese and veggies. No sweets etc.

Hi Kay

I've bought a tub of Simpkins sugar free pops that say they are 0 sugars and starch and 88.0 grams of polyols per 100g and one lolly is 15g. None of this matters much as I can tell you they are tasteless. There is a strawberry and cream lolly that is 0 Carbs that I've bought for the children before as it's sugar free and tastes lovely so I'd buy those if I was buying again.

Sometimes I just have an overwhelming need for something sweet, just one mouthful usually satisfies me, so I bought a box of Atkins Endulge peanut caramel bars. 1.5g sugars 135 cal and only 2.1 carbs. Believe me when I say you could never eat a whole bar, they have a rather weird texture but are okish. I keep one in my bag as an emergency rather than being completely starving if I'm out somewhere and can't get to a low carb option in time.

Can't remember which website I got these all from but they were not cheap, although the company delivered promptly and well packed etc.
